What number decides where your ADU goes isn't a zoning bylaw, and it won't be the same as someone in the next town over.
Quick Answer: State law requires a 100-foot buffer zone around certain types of wetlands and everything inside it is governed by your local Conservation Commission. Your town then determines a tighter no-touch line within that buffer zone and that will decide where your ADU can be built. On our South Shore projects we've done those no-touch distances were 50 feet in Scituate, 75 in Marshfield, 65 in Carver, and 50 in Kingston. Massachusetts has no fixed no-touch distance of its own so be sure to check your town's current figure with its Conservation Commission before you pay for design, because Title 5 septic setbacks apply on top of that.

Where Does the Wetland Line Actually Stop You?
Two separate entities control a wet lot, and homeowners almost always find the wrong one first. The first one, which is the Massachusetts Wetlands Protection Act, is governed by the state. This Act deals with the work that's done inside 100 feet of a wetland resource area and your local conservation commission will review each project case by case using those rules. You can read the state's summary of that jurisdiction at mass.gov.
The second thing is what can stop construction. Within that 100-foot buffer, towns have a tighter no-touch zone in their own wetlands bylaw, and inside the no-touch zone you aren't allowed to build. The no-touch distance is set town by town, not by the state. That's why two families just a mile apart, on lots that look identical will get two different answers about ADU construction.
So the question isn't if you can build near a wetland. It's where your town's line is and then where the septic code puts your leaching field in relation to that same wetland. Those two distances together tell you where you have to fit an ADU into.
The Wetland Edge Is a Surveyed Line You Can Locate
Bordering vegetated wetland is called BVW on plans and permits, and it's the state's name for the wet ground around a pond, stream, lake, or river: the marsh, swamp, bog, or wet meadow at the edge of the water. It's a legal boundary that's decided by soils, vegetation, and hydrology, not just by where the ground looks soft in the spring. Every buffer and setback distance that we're giving you is measured horizontally from the outermost boundary and that's why this boundary has to be determined before distances mean anything.
The edge is found by a wetland scientist who walks the line and sets up flags. Then a surveyor picks up the flags and puts them on a plan. That process is a negotiation. On a survey day you could spend hours arguing about whether one flag should be moved two feet this way or two feet that way, because moving a flag two feet means two feet off every setback that follows it.
Before any of that is paid for, you can find approximate answers working from a desk. A civil engineer can look at the state's mapping and tell you whether wetlands or floodplains are involved on the project at all. It isn't a precise number and it won't work for the hearing, but it will tell you in one day whether you need to worry about this or not.
Why Is Every Town's No-Touch Number Different?
The no-touch distances didn't come out of a study. They came out of town meeting votes, one town at a time, and they've been going up for 30 years. When we started, there wasn't a no-touch zone, then it was 10 feet, and then 15, 25 and finally 50. The state doesn't have one. Massachusetts lets the commission have jurisdiction over the 100-foot buffer and then requires a review of every case, measuring it by performance standards. The hard line inside the buffer is an invention of your town and each town has its own.
That's not a complaint about the boards but it is a warning about your planning. Because these numbers are local policy then you can't argue about them and they don't go with you from the town that you used to live in. The only number that controls your ADU project is the one the Conservation Commission is currently enforcing.
Here's what we have worked with on our recent South Shore projects. Use these as the starting point when you call the commission, not as the final decision, because wetlands bylaws get changed and the commission is the one who decides the number.
| Town | No-touch distance we have worked to |
|---|---|
| Scituate | 50 feet |
| Marshfield | 75 feet |
| Carver | 65 feet |
| Kingston | 50 feet |
| Massachusetts (state) | Not a definite no-touch distance. Case-by-case review inside the 100-foot buffer zone. |
The difference between the towns is the whole point. A Marshfield lot loses 25 more feet off the back than the same lot in Scituate, and 25 feet can decide if a detached ADU will fit behind the house or doesn't fit at all.
Does the Buffer Apply to Your Septic System Too?
It does, and in our experience it's the septic system and not the ADU itself that makes the difference. Under Title 5, the state septic code, the soil absorption system, which is the leaching field, has to be at least 50 feet from a bordering vegetated wetland, and the septic tank at least 25 feet. Local boards may require more than that. The full setback information is at mass.gov.
Some towns go a lot farther than that. In Kingston, no part of the septic system can be inside the buffer zone at all: not the leaching field, not the tank, not the pipe. Part has to be more than 100 feet from the wetland, and it's measured from the point where the first inch of pipe comes from the foundation.
That's why we plan out the septic system before we lay out the ADU when there is a wetland involved, which is backwards from how most builders work and backwards from how most homeowners think of it. A leaching field has to have a certain area of undisturbed soil at a specific elevation, and it can't be pushed six feet like a building can. So we plan the wetland edge first, then the town's no-touch line, then the setback for the septic and the reserve area you have to have in case the system ever fails. Whatever's left is the space we design for. Doing the order backwards from this makes a beautiful drawing of a building without any place for its wastewater to go, and we've been given this drawing by families who already paid for it.
Part of the rule isn't logical and it's worth pointing out because it influences how you see the numbers. The leaching field distance makes sense: that's where treated wastewater goes into the ground. The tank and the pipe are a closed system. Holding them to the time line or to a longer one, is just a policy choice not a scientific finding. That doesn't make the rule optional. It makes it something to measure early.
The Buffer Takes a Band Across the Full Width of Your Lot
The design of the loss surprises people more than the size of it. A buffer isn't a circle that's drawn around a puddle in one corner. It goes horizontally from the edge of the property farthest away from the water so a wetland along the back of your property takes away a uniform strip across the entire rear of the lot. Then when you add a 75-foot no-touch band at the back, the zoning setbacks off your side and rear property lines, the necessary distance between the ADU and the main house, and the septic distances from that same wetland edge, and the area you can build get smaller in all directions.
This is how Plymouth County ended up with single pieces of land scattered through it: strips and back corners left behind because they supposedly didn't meet the setbacks, and nobody has been able to use them since. Those pieces aren't bad land. They are land whose usable middle got measured away.
On a wet lot, three measurements settle where and if you can build before anything else does:
- The wetland edge, marked by a wetland scientist and put on a plan by a surveyor
- Your town's no-touch distance, measured horizontally from that edge
- The Title 5 septic distances and the reserve area, measured from the same edge
Size, layout, number of bedrooms, and finishes all come after these three things. Families who check on them first keep their options. Families who leave it for last end up paying more. Twice.
When Is a Wetland Lot Not Worth Designing Around?
We build ADUs for a living, so you'd expect us to tell you that there's a solution for every property. But there isn't. When a wetland runs the full width of the back of a small lot, the town has a 75-foot no-touch line, and the septic has to leave the wetland with a reserve area, then there are properties where the area that's left to build on is too small to comply with code and no amount of design will fix it. On those lots the honest answer is to stop before you end up paying a design fee instead of later.
We also can't tell you what your Conservation Commission will decide. Commissions review work on a case by case basis and make a decision based on the performance standards in the regulations. That decision is theirs, not your builder's. What we can do is give you an accurate plan of where the lines are, so you can have a conversation with the commission based on facts instead of a hopeful sketch. Anyone who tells you they can negotiate your buffer down is trying to sell you something.
The reason we'd prefer to give you a difficult answer early is simple. A family who finds out in the first week that the back of the lot isn't available to build on, still has money and choices. A family who finds that out in month four has a folder of drawings and a decision they were already attached to.
